Seaside Music Pub Beats the Odds to Become Somerset’s Beloved Venue Saturday, August 30, 2025 music venue clevedon community live arts pandemic entertainment musicians performance In the wake of the Covid-19 pandemic, many pubs struggled to survive, yet The Riff Corner, a live music venue in Clevedon, Somerset, has celebrated three years of thriving success. Opening its doors in August 2020, this … Read More